func (*BOMFile) Name added in v0.13.0

func (b *BOMFile) Name() (string, error)

Name() returns the destination filename for a given BOM file cdx files should be renamed to "sbom.cdx.json" spdx files should be renamed to "sbom.spdx.json" syft files should be renamed to "sbom.syft.json" If the BOM is neither cdx, spdx, nor syft, the 2nd return argument will return an error to indicate an unsupported format

type GroupBuildpack

type GroupBuildpack struct {
	API      string `toml:"api,omitempty" json:"-"`
	Homepage string `toml:"homepage,omitempty" json:"homepage,omitempty"`
	ID       string `toml:"id" json:"id"`
	Optional bool   `toml:"optional,omitempty" json:"optional,omitempty"`
	Version  string `toml:"version" json:"version"`
}

A GroupBuildpack represents a buildpack referenced in a buildpack.toml's [[order.group]]. It may be a regular buildpack, or a meta buildpack.
